When a user views a 3D model on a website using WebGL frameworks (like Three.js or Babylon.js), the raw vertex data, textures, and meshes are loaded into the computer's graphics card (GPU) and browser memory. Ripping tools intercept this data stream, reconstituting the fragments back into standard file formats like .obj or .fbx . 2. Specialized Scraping Software

The dangers of ripping extend to the end-users of these stolen assets. Indie game developers or digital agencies who download ripped models from third-party piracy sites run massive legal risks. Utilizing copyrighted, stolen material in a commercial project can result in Digital Millennium Copyright Act (DMCA) takedown notices, expensive lawsuits, and forced pulling of a product from storefronts like Steam or the iOS App Store. Many 3D models come with strict royalty or non-commercial licenses. A ripper ignores these legal bounds, often using assets for commercial video games, virtual reality projects, or 3D printing without paying the proper licensing fees. 3. Platform Security and Economic Impact
Piracy creates an environment where consumers expect high-end digital assets to be cheap or free. This forces legitimate creators to lower their prices, making digital artistry a less viable full-time career.
